From 018f63991bf194f27f28e5f478eb7c5a8784aa89 Mon Sep 17 00:00:00 2001 From: La Programmatrice Verde Date: Fri, 10 Jan 2025 09:14:13 +0100 Subject: [PATCH] Opzione 2 --- Program.cs | 26 ++++++++++++------ bin/Debug/net9.0/ripasso1.dll | Bin 5632 -> 5632 bytes bin/Debug/net9.0/ripasso1.pdb | Bin 10972 -> 11064 bytes obj/Debug/net9.0/ref/ripasso1.dll | Bin 5120 -> 5120 bytes obj/Debug/net9.0/refint/ripasso1.dll | Bin 5120 -> 5120 bytes obj/Debug/net9.0/ripasso1.AssemblyInfo.cs | 2 +- .../net9.0/ripasso1.AssemblyInfoInputs.cache | 2 +- obj/Debug/net9.0/ripasso1.dll | Bin 5632 -> 5632 bytes obj/Debug/net9.0/ripasso1.pdb | Bin 10972 -> 11064 bytes 9 files changed, 19 insertions(+), 11 deletions(-) diff --git a/Program.cs b/Program.cs index 4c4f5ad..00101f7 100644 --- a/Program.cs +++ b/Program.cs @@ -4,8 +4,9 @@ class Program { static void Main(string[] args) { - //dichiarazione variabili - int scelta, i, numero; + //dichiarazione e inizializzazione variabili + int scelta, i, numero, somma; + somma = 0; bool positiviPari = true; //menu do { @@ -22,24 +23,22 @@ class Program case 0: break; case 1: - do - { + do{ Console.Write("Numeri da inserire: "); i = Convert.ToInt32(Console.ReadLine()); - if (i <= 0) - { + if (i <= 0){ Console.WriteLine("Opzione non valida"); } } while (i <= 0); - for(; i > 0; i--){ + for (; i > 0; i--){ Console.Write("Inserire un numero: "); numero = Convert.ToInt32(Console.ReadLine()); if(numero < 0 || numero % 2 != 0){ positiviPari = false; } } - if(positiviPari == true){ + if (positiviPari == true){ Console.WriteLine("Tutti positivi e pari"); } else{ @@ -47,7 +46,16 @@ class Program } break; case 2: - break; + do{ + Console.Write("Inserire un numero: "); + numero = Convert.ToInt32(Console.ReadLine()); + if (!((numero < 0 && numero % 2 == 0) || (numero >= 0 && numero % 3 == 0))){ + somma = somma + numero; + } + } + while (!((numero < 0 && numero % 2 == 0) || (numero >= 0 && numero % 3 == 0))); + Console.WriteLine("Somma: " + somma); + break; case 3: break; case 4: diff --git a/bin/Debug/net9.0/ripasso1.dll b/bin/Debug/net9.0/ripasso1.dll index 578013a0a872058f3cf1fbb06b11917e144db320..e47916813c6a4d968c12aa69594a98b4143e681e 100644 GIT binary patch delta 1479 zcmZ`(UuauZ82_D{+?$(!H@UrSy0W^Z&AMbuTGO;?lMZFBv)XO7wOw_!43{>s4z$&5 zC{}H11yS%};lgk)iggd_K!(w`;h00md}={K!GVaNFEU>Q5l#J_+ipzI@80iszklaD z-#Op8XF0W;I`g_a{`>Te>YJ^~YO?y_BgR8XU=*bNz567*mTIc^ ztBjTGBY#ZJFs_%J>y~hcfbs_LOu~>ci4ZXnCip#(x)P}i%VT;{L6r9h#soL>+;Zur z-gzb2i}I*+{wsluViR7#0i=jW9LzJpE9^rS zZ=faySi)iDUV014L7Zf~hA3vyCgPYzTy(*YW9Wi~0&zQ*i7}4sLNbbL{Pf@(;y(O9 z9K^50!;XCd*X(t*qiI++oaA+I6NYPk?UGQBF0keHRgbL=F3issPS+;&FU78=K`dY% zMHaJ2mU0OQO;CE8PXPmn+AY43sjd%(b~U#CJo-+|cfIY;&xYWR3Zc8A5Gn=Jl&T>? zH9aAnr10G$H|TQ#1_j;V7(<0(7*t`7*q``5s+78CdyCmpPfw{QpUD-|nNqHpDduLg z#X_+!-CZj671DkAnSS0CPIGm^ow`Mf{TJVc7#WkTe3ZP#Jy?^M))vW=Ay02yGXIn~ z|HL~f4EslaL-@TD`3sj%g+^b!*!=ewzufhh?G7BuY#DdDwv2MF?awcL-@1G8^4Qwy zSI=!-fimA2DMzbq5oIN5zZE!JGYp?=w8RrIi(YPVmRsAyM`9isqe70}v^>kjH_H^{*ENjE- zv6d$-+8xWbG6rId_O*`(b+qHR{ab(XI{`bO-t=sGHoZBWOvlrk)})=j@OXx9oAW%K z<`S6D3EIK!U$-7TN+o6YI$c0Y4I5i_+~tZoPXeP7c#Y~DduRH{(Ze$=9TyGYfgayK zhVv#6rLVKHf9OTNuhQPEE*V{OoQ3N!L`6iJ_`u~}{3o73 zFGEbs;!9zoDsGXtp}F9)=`!p3>u&!6bcUUBnK46iOcX#8u0dA-e~M*yE?tN&K^sy0 zzyb=cH5%9c27VTUv=Cex(~?2vxkXS7Y4=pX~=A*0ylvh4DCmqVD-1AAO! z+~ou*aGYF^6WGbWp1^LGW%S}B?tG4(J+dE17-J%iNwkSB9K=S^iy(#>X>!9Y5H#p^-o}! zTN9j5jx6=x+%<2X{p;0-#WQMmaAPv!3t5&W`E#2AAtD|i!j4729#mfhFV7Wn`D!)S zS1nG~>V^7LAy=x^Yo+`|eyUt9Y%3SbrO9HoKU?R$aJSzQT-W3F&3xrIh?n(=!zl=1CP?x At^fc4 diff --git a/bin/Debug/net9.0/ripasso1.pdb b/bin/Debug/net9.0/ripasso1.pdb index 218adb185cd2ed8e9200db6c5efb0c7c5b4f485d..5800ae7796d3baaf5027f52af7cb49c3e9905882 100644 GIT binary patch delta 617 zcmX|8Pe>GT6#m|u*~x9lg>u_A+nU&2*Rg*T8`U8MSy-}Q1KWha%(5a_Gn#_zunw!G zmr9xF5_rkOkOh+T_aX##5kd$G#Dh^#Qil#f5D2~BwCphN&G-I%-|xNOEEQj!9Lo;+ z0Fq^(L_kX6j%!yhUB2iD#F*rCl`D4OzTo2u=Zi;j^8G6D30vZ}QvX?rADuZgHS0tQ zL({RuJqKiMvM>_&uA2{1xy|F zf>ou#RtgqEXt6U=El@^goYaD{)8E(EqtPdBW4QhO)6;hoGfC}F zdVQBnM@ERS)~I8|8Jd@|TL*QW(8RilW`+qf*i@GxHu2Zqy2Ly{}WxN`eeZUL1OdOshe~SEfB-%R~C5q6Aw4>tt&jTn{VG?_c8tfcSCUj delta 528 zcmdlHb|-X#N&Nx_1_tFi28I+y1_l`rJGi7MGcUau$Yf{$im`yiLW3Dvfb0Me+db6N z1xQ~3@;Nkte5aiJBp}~2XxBeB_W=JrRmHV}CXrz)C%NASDq(XMWn$n2$^+R9fA1H;74ri?5TU)qPqfdqg6L@_c514$+ZQ6S08zyTydViz<(dKDO08J=mV1I7Ir z)q$>C!VDBFPEO4!Nn|LkpciSj*z-_+Vd&P-kJAd9Isz<$ zHp{hDCX{bBX8x|qD+zQTBO5CtgCrXV(_|Y>`+7E@)6|$axEX-X<7VIn`<8`)kqIcQ z0TO0ps$_%^{7^Zd&ls7MK)TYo8FWFq6qy+KK|#&P;Kaxv%H$4G0Mo@>D#Zfyb1@r8 zfdpSE(7zys28;~aOp)9SlYePSaWOHlu~dQxhRLy7^Gp*MSEMtpXkuK^!?r5@`Osxe>wG0dZ>QQP| diff --git a/obj/Debug/net9.0/ref/ripasso1.dll b/obj/Debug/net9.0/ref/ripasso1.dll index 6fbb18d9b898d9ba53180f195456ae69c1b996de..383a7807cb33497569c368067e52dba4fb26aaa6 100644 GIT binary patch delta 194 zcmZqBXwaC@!Q%M%!TpUrCCmbUthJ6UZgTM1(`q8_tbT0UW*ZvY?5M{YHXZpY-wbXVqlbNkz$l$k!+fhm||vNn3`&qXkccUWWL#s`xdi*DuW?I zGJ^?23WF&_DuXc)f=EjSBL)kgm;sPZ1+$ERJPV*oQy`rP#AZM_L!ewLkd+8zn*sGC MF_>>o=by;}01`np-2eap delta 194 zcmZqBXwaC@!E)Q?T=&MF5@vz#@AKtmy8iH96p+C+@kNQgl4hEgYHDPWl9pm&oM@bCX=!R`X=Z7WY?fqhkha;5`xdjmDT5J% zF+&m%8ZnpvNi&9Ih7^W022&tT1(HS#7GQn~kTzyW1maW%OCU65Fa(ljKx_fjVFuJ` O&S1chwmF@DCJO+}LpJOH diff --git a/obj/Debug/net9.0/refint/ripasso1.dll b/obj/Debug/net9.0/refint/ripasso1.dll index 6fbb18d9b898d9ba53180f195456ae69c1b996de..383a7807cb33497569c368067e52dba4fb26aaa6 100644 GIT binary patch delta 194 zcmZqBXwaC@!Q%M%!TpUrCCmbUthJ6UZgTM1(`q8_tbT0UW*ZvY?5M{YHXZpY-wbXVqlbNkz$l$k!+fhm||vNn3`&qXkccUWWL#s`xdi*DuW?I zGJ^?23WF&_DuXc)f=EjSBL)kgm;sPZ1+$ERJPV*oQy`rP#AZM_L!ewLkd+8zn*sGC MF_>>o=by;}01`np-2eap delta 194 zcmZqBXwaC@!E)Q?T=&MF5@vz#@AKtmy8iH96p+C+@kNQgl4hEgYHDPWl9pm&oM@bCX=!R`X=Z7WY?fqhkha;5`xdjmDT5J% zF+&m%8ZnpvNi&9Ih7^W022&tT1(HS#7GQn~kTzyW1maW%OCU65Fa(ljKx_fjVFuJ` O&S1chwmF@DCJO+}LpJOH diff --git a/obj/Debug/net9.0/ripasso1.AssemblyInfo.cs b/obj/Debug/net9.0/ripasso1.AssemblyInfo.cs index 56944e5..d082391 100644 --- a/obj/Debug/net9.0/ripasso1.AssemblyInfo.cs +++ b/obj/Debug/net9.0/ripasso1.AssemblyInfo.cs @@ -13,7 +13,7 @@ using System.Reflection; [assembly: System.Reflection.AssemblyCompanyAttribute("ripasso1")] [assembly: System.Reflection.AssemblyConfigurationAttribute("Debug")] [assembly: System.Reflection.AssemblyFileVersionAttribute("1.0.0.0")] -[assembly: System.Reflection.AssemblyInformationalVersionAttribute("1.0.0+523bb24b6cdf5fe528dfd83a3e99519698c6b70f")] +[assembly: System.Reflection.AssemblyInformationalVersionAttribute("1.0.0+e1c4d5e33e3928d02e8d2d8c5dad601ee6a069b7")] [assembly: System.Reflection.AssemblyProductAttribute("ripasso1")] [assembly: System.Reflection.AssemblyTitleAttribute("ripasso1")] [assembly: System.Reflection.AssemblyVersionAttribute("1.0.0.0")] diff --git a/obj/Debug/net9.0/ripasso1.AssemblyInfoInputs.cache b/obj/Debug/net9.0/ripasso1.AssemblyInfoInputs.cache index 5717ede..076d1cd 100644 --- a/obj/Debug/net9.0/ripasso1.AssemblyInfoInputs.cache +++ b/obj/Debug/net9.0/ripasso1.AssemblyInfoInputs.cache @@ -1 +1 @@ -9ae844eabdb834620e40c9ba6eb3b842d15c778fa257263021e9ad9254162faf +f2c5cde86cd7c9aecef2ceb3af53f8d967d88c13fffb33996563a5258c59d278 diff --git a/obj/Debug/net9.0/ripasso1.dll b/obj/Debug/net9.0/ripasso1.dll index 578013a0a872058f3cf1fbb06b11917e144db320..e47916813c6a4d968c12aa69594a98b4143e681e 100644 GIT binary patch delta 1479 zcmZ`(UuauZ82_D{+?$(!H@UrSy0W^Z&AMbuTGO;?lMZFBv)XO7wOw_!43{>s4z$&5 zC{}H11yS%};lgk)iggd_K!(w`;h00md}={K!GVaNFEU>Q5l#J_+ipzI@80iszklaD z-#Op8XF0W;I`g_a{`>Te>YJ^~YO?y_BgR8XU=*bNz567*mTIc^ ztBjTGBY#ZJFs_%J>y~hcfbs_LOu~>ci4ZXnCip#(x)P}i%VT;{L6r9h#soL>+;Zur z-gzb2i}I*+{wsluViR7#0i=jW9LzJpE9^rS zZ=faySi)iDUV014L7Zf~hA3vyCgPYzTy(*YW9Wi~0&zQ*i7}4sLNbbL{Pf@(;y(O9 z9K^50!;XCd*X(t*qiI++oaA+I6NYPk?UGQBF0keHRgbL=F3issPS+;&FU78=K`dY% zMHaJ2mU0OQO;CE8PXPmn+AY43sjd%(b~U#CJo-+|cfIY;&xYWR3Zc8A5Gn=Jl&T>? zH9aAnr10G$H|TQ#1_j;V7(<0(7*t`7*q``5s+78CdyCmpPfw{QpUD-|nNqHpDduLg z#X_+!-CZj671DkAnSS0CPIGm^ow`Mf{TJVc7#WkTe3ZP#Jy?^M))vW=Ay02yGXIn~ z|HL~f4EslaL-@TD`3sj%g+^b!*!=ewzufhh?G7BuY#DdDwv2MF?awcL-@1G8^4Qwy zSI=!-fimA2DMzbq5oIN5zZE!JGYp?=w8RrIi(YPVmRsAyM`9isqe70}v^>kjH_H^{*ENjE- zv6d$-+8xWbG6rId_O*`(b+qHR{ab(XI{`bO-t=sGHoZBWOvlrk)})=j@OXx9oAW%K z<`S6D3EIK!U$-7TN+o6YI$c0Y4I5i_+~tZoPXeP7c#Y~DduRH{(Ze$=9TyGYfgayK zhVv#6rLVKHf9OTNuhQPEE*V{OoQ3N!L`6iJ_`u~}{3o73 zFGEbs;!9zoDsGXtp}F9)=`!p3>u&!6bcUUBnK46iOcX#8u0dA-e~M*yE?tN&K^sy0 zzyb=cH5%9c27VTUv=Cex(~?2vxkXS7Y4=pX~=A*0ylvh4DCmqVD-1AAO! z+~ou*aGYF^6WGbWp1^LGW%S}B?tG4(J+dE17-J%iNwkSB9K=S^iy(#>X>!9Y5H#p^-o}! zTN9j5jx6=x+%<2X{p;0-#WQMmaAPv!3t5&W`E#2AAtD|i!j4729#mfhFV7Wn`D!)S zS1nG~>V^7LAy=x^Yo+`|eyUt9Y%3SbrO9HoKU?R$aJSzQT-W3F&3xrIh?n(=!zl=1CP?x At^fc4 diff --git a/obj/Debug/net9.0/ripasso1.pdb b/obj/Debug/net9.0/ripasso1.pdb index 218adb185cd2ed8e9200db6c5efb0c7c5b4f485d..5800ae7796d3baaf5027f52af7cb49c3e9905882 100644 GIT binary patch delta 617 zcmX|8Pe>GT6#m|u*~x9lg>u_A+nU&2*Rg*T8`U8MSy-}Q1KWha%(5a_Gn#_zunw!G zmr9xF5_rkOkOh+T_aX##5kd$G#Dh^#Qil#f5D2~BwCphN&G-I%-|xNOEEQj!9Lo;+ z0Fq^(L_kX6j%!yhUB2iD#F*rCl`D4OzTo2u=Zi;j^8G6D30vZ}QvX?rADuZgHS0tQ zL({RuJqKiMvM>_&uA2{1xy|F zf>ou#RtgqEXt6U=El@^goYaD{)8E(EqtPdBW4QhO)6;hoGfC}F zdVQBnM@ERS)~I8|8Jd@|TL*QW(8RilW`+qf*i@GxHu2Zqy2Ly{}WxN`eeZUL1OdOshe~SEfB-%R~C5q6Aw4>tt&jTn{VG?_c8tfcSCUj delta 528 zcmdlHb|-X#N&Nx_1_tFi28I+y1_l`rJGi7MGcUau$Yf{$im`yiLW3Dvfb0Me+db6N z1xQ~3@;Nkte5aiJBp}~2XxBeB_W=JrRmHV}CXrz)C%NASDq(XMWn$n2$^+R9fA1H;74ri?5TU)qPqfdqg6L@_c514$+ZQ6S08zyTydViz<(dKDO08J=mV1I7Ir z)q$>C!VDBFPEO4!Nn|LkpciSj*z-_+Vd&P-kJAd9Isz<$ zHp{hDCX{bBX8x|qD+zQTBO5CtgCrXV(_|Y>`+7E@)6|$axEX-X<7VIn`<8`)kqIcQ z0TO0ps$_%^{7^Zd&ls7MK)TYo8FWFq6qy+KK|#&P;Kaxv%H$4G0Mo@>D#Zfyb1@r8 zfdpSE(7zys28;~aOp)9SlYePSaWOHlu~dQxhRLy7^Gp*MSEMtpXkuK^!?r5@`Osxe>wG0dZ>QQP|